Output e2d96b8924ed7fb8c1f37a7fcca305ce5638e66e1470be629ffd7d59841d223f:1

value
18665354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d7741cfa28fd3178ea328eaee0f1f56e42b299a OP_EQUALVERIFY OP_CHECKSIG
address
1Q7CpfGu8rGnVweyMnPxauumdETFyS6cJr
transaction
e2d96b8924ed7fb8c1f37a7fcca305ce5638e66e1470be629ffd7d59841d223f
confirmations
278277
spent
true